http://www.insightmag.com/news/2004/07/19/Politics/Barack.Obama.Hit.F... Barack Obama Hit for Vote on Sex-Assault Bill
Posted July 28, 2004
Illinois state Sen. Barack Obama's vote AGAINST tougher sentences for
sexual predators surfaced Tuesday prior to his keynote address to the
Democratic National Convention in Boston.
In 1999 Obama cast the lone vote against a proposed Illinois law to
deny early release on the grounds of "good behavior" for felons
incarcerated for criminal sexual offenses, said a group identifying
itself as the "Obama Truth Squad."
Known in Illinois as Senate Bill 485, it provided that a person in a
county jail, "May not receive a good behavior allowance if he or she
is convicted of criminal sexual assault in which the victim was under
18 years of age at the time of the offense" or was "a family member"
or if "he or she is convicted of criminal sexual abuse or aggravated
criminal sexual abuse."
Obama voted against the measure, which became law on July 15, 1999,
the group said, in a news release timed to coincide with Obama's
speech to Boston delegates of the Democratic convention.
Obama is the Democrat's candidate for the U.S. Senate in Illinois and
considered a heavy favorite to win, in part because the Republicans
have yet to field a candidate.
